Transaction 99f588871e04a55ffe09984a7978ea8bfc3ccf344aead32b2523388cc340a4e3

1 Input
2 Outputs
  • 99f588871e04a55ffe09984a7978ea8bfc3ccf344aead32b2523388cc340a4e3:0
  • value  2348688
    address  3Bvy9H23jU465AcjJ1HyZHnJDrwRD6b6Mb
  • 99f588871e04a55ffe09984a7978ea8bfc3ccf344aead32b2523388cc340a4e3:1
  • value  2618619
    address  bc1qmsucya2xgq7ngxyjnuwnc0lzgc8tus27h3dc9t